[0001] This invention relates to the field of harvesting equipment technology, and in particular to a toothed comb-type harvester. Background Technology

[0002] Honeysuckle, a perennial semi-evergreen vine belonging to the Caprifoliaceae family, is a traditional and commonly used Chinese medicinal herb. It is also known as "silver flower" or "winter honeysuckle." The current Chinese Pharmacopoeia defines honeysuckle as "the dried flower buds or newly opened flowers of *Lonicera japonica*, a plant in the Caprifoliaceae family." Honeysuckle is not only a major traditional Chinese medicinal herb but also a plant used for both medicinal and edible purposes. Its medicinal and pharmacological functions include clearing heat and detoxifying, dispersing wind-heat, and antibacterial and antiviral effects. Many daily chemical products also use honeysuckle as a raw material. Furthermore, with the improvement of people's living standards, health foods and beverages made from honeysuckle have developed rapidly. With the increasing planting area of ​​honeysuckle and the continuous development of agronomy, manual harvesting of honeysuckle can no longer meet the economic and profit-seeking pursuit of farmers.

[0003] Currently, most honeysuckle harvesting devices on the market are handheld, with low levels of automation. They primarily assist manual harvesting and do not reduce labor intensity. They cannot operate efficiently and continuously, resulting in low harvesting efficiency and unsuitability for large-scale honeysuckle harvesting, thus hindering the development of the honeysuckle industry. Therefore, there is an urgent need to develop automated field machinery suitable for honeysuckle harvesting to reduce labor intensity, lower costs and increase efficiency for honeysuckle growers, and promote the large-scale development of the honeysuckle industry. [0044] Example 1

[0045] This embodiment provides a toothed comb-type harvester 100, mainly used for harvesting honeysuckle, but not limited to, other types of honeysuckle. Figures 1-5As shown, the machine includes a frame 10, a walking system, and a harvesting mechanism. The length direction of the frame 10 is taken as the first direction, and the width direction of the frame 10 is taken as the second direction. The first direction is perpendicular to the second direction and parallel to the traveling direction of the frame 10. A harvesting gap 11 extending through the first direction is provided at the bottom of the frame 10. The walking system is used to move the frame 10. The harvesting mechanism includes two toothed brush devices 20, each with a rotating harvesting belt 23. Multiple harvesting teeth 24 are fixed on the harvesting belt 23. The two harvesting belts 23 are symmetrically arranged on both sides of the harvesting gap 11. The sides of the two harvesting belts 23 closest to the entry end of the harvesting gap 11 are further apart in the second direction, while the sides of the two harvesting belts 23 furthest from the entry end of the harvesting gap 11 are closer together in the second direction.

[0046] The walking system moves the equipment to the harvested plants, allowing the plants to pass through the harvesting gap 11 in sequence. The equipment then self-propelledly straddles the plants. Two toothed brush devices 20 are symmetrically arranged in a "V" shape, with the gap between them gradually narrowing from front to back. The front section of the two devices forms a feeding inlet, facilitating the entry of the plants into the harvesting area. The plants within the harvesting gap 11 are rotated by the harvesting belts 23 with harvesting teeth 24 on the toothed brush devices 20 on both sides. The brushing force applied to the harvested plants gradually increases as the distance between the two toothed brush devices 20 decreases, creating a brushing effect that is gentler at the front and more rigid at the back. Compared to the traditional method of applying a constant brushing force to the harvested plants, this method improves harvesting efficiency and reduces damage to the branches of the harvested plants, thus affecting the yield of the following year. The toothed brush devices 20, arranged in a "V" shape, create a brushing effect that is gentler at the front and more rigid at the back, enabling automated, continuous, and highly efficient harvesting, while reducing the labor intensity and labor costs for workers.

[0047] Specifically, necessary shielding plates are installed on the machine frame 10 around the harvesting operation area at the harvesting interval 11 to ensure a closed effect, prevent the harvested materials from falling outside the harvesting operation area, and improve the collection effect.

[0048] Specifically, the "V" shape formed by the two toothed comb brush devices 20 has an inner angle of 20°, that is, one side is at a 10° angle to the forward direction.

[0049] Specifically, a temporary storage area for receiving harvested materials is provided on the machine frame 10 located on both sides of the harvesting gap 11 and below the toothed comb device 20.

[0050] Specifically, the temporary storage area can be a directly set plane or a cavity. The plane can be formed by the upper surface of a flat plate, and the cavity can be formed by welding together a plate structure. The temporary storage area can also be an automatic convergence mechanism formed by a first transmission belt mechanism and a second transmission belt mechanism 42 and a corresponding collection box 50 to realize the automatic collection of the harvested materials.

[0051] In the optional solutions of this embodiment, the more preferred one is shown in the figure. Figures 3-5 As shown, the toothed belt comb device 20 includes a picking driver, a picking drive shaft 21, a picking driven shaft 22, and a picking belt 23; a connecting frame 12 for mounting the toothed belt comb device 20 is provided on the machine frame 10; the axis of the picking drive shaft 21 and the axis of the picking driven shaft 22 are parallel and both are parallel to the horizontal plane; both ends of the picking drive shaft 21 and the picking driven shaft 22 are rotatably mounted on the connecting frame 12; the picking belt 23 is sleeved on the outside of the picking drive shaft 21 and the picking driven shaft 22; the picking driver is used to drive the picking drive shaft 21 to rotate; the distance between the end of the picking drive shaft 21 near the entry end of the harvesting gap 11 and the harvesting gap 11 in the second direction is greater than the distance between the end of the picking drive shaft 21 away from the entry end of the harvesting gap 11 and the harvesting gap 11 in the second direction. The toothed belt comb device 20 drives the picking drive shaft 21 to rotate through the picking driver, which in turn drives the picking belt 23 and the picking driven shaft 22 to rotate. Its structure is simple and is a simple conveyor belt structure. It can be completed by adding picking teeth 24 to the existing conveyor belt structure, which is convenient for processing and manufacturing and reduces manufacturing costs.

[0052] Specifically, the harvesting drive uses a hydraulic motor.

[0053] Specifically, the two ends of the harvesting drive shaft 21 are mounted on the connecting frame 12 via self-aligning bearings 25.

[0054] Specifically, multiple mounting plates are fixedly installed on the picking belt 23. The extension direction of the mounting plates is parallel to the axis of the picking drive shaft 21. Multiple picking teeth 24 plates are fixedly installed on the mounting plates, and multiple picking teeth 24 are fixedly installed on each picking tooth 24 plate.

[0055] Specifically, the connection between the mounting plate and the picking tooth 24 plate can be any existing detachable connection method. For example, the mounting plate is provided with multiple first connection holes, and the picking tooth 24 plate is provided with multiple second connection holes. Each first connection hole corresponds to one second connection hole, and the picking tooth 24 plate is fixed to the mounting plate by bolts and nuts.

[0056] Specifically, the picking belt 23 rotates from bottom to top relative to the harvested plants.

[0057] Specifically, the outer side of the picking teeth 24 is coated with rubber to reduce damage to the harvested plants and harvested materials when the picking teeth 24 brushes the harvested plants. The rubber coating also increases the surface friction coefficient during picking, thereby improving the picking efficiency and picking speed.

[0058] Among the optional solutions in this embodiment, the more preferred one is as follows: Figure 3 and Figure 5 As shown, both ends of the picking driven shaft 22 are connected to the connecting frame 12 via a tensioning mechanism 30. The output end of each tensioning mechanism 30 is connected to the corresponding end of the picking driven shaft 22, and the output end of each tensioning mechanism 30 can drive the end of the picking driven shaft 22 to move away from the picking drive shaft 21. The tensioning mechanism 30 can adjust the tension of the picking belt 23, thereby adjusting the brushing effect of the picking teeth 24 on the harvested plants.

[0059] Specifically, the tensioning mechanism 30 can be any existing structure capable of adjusting tension. Here, one such structure is described. The tensioning mechanism 30 includes a tensioning frame 31, an adjusting screw 32, an adjusting nut, and a slider 33. The tensioning frame 31 is fixed on the connecting frame 12 and has a sliding groove. The slider 33 is slidably disposed in the sliding groove and can move closer to or away from the harvesting drive shaft 21. The ends of the harvesting driven shaft 22 are rotatably connected to the corresponding sliders 33. The tensioning frame 31 has a guide hole, and the adjusting screw 32 passes through the guide hole. One end of the adjusting screw 32 is connected to the slider 33, and an adjusting nut is provided on each of the adjusting screws 32 located on both sides of the guide hole. The extension and retraction of the adjusting screw 32 in the guide hole can drive the slider 33 to move closer to or away from the harvesting drive shaft 21.

[0060] Among the optional solutions in this embodiment, the more preferred one is as follows: Figures 1-3 As shown, the machine frame 10 is also equipped with two transmission devices 40, each corresponding to a toothed belt comb device 20. Each transmission device 40 has a total transmission surface, with a portion of the total transmission surface located below the corresponding toothed belt comb device 20. The output end of the total transmission surface is connected to a collection box 50. The transmission devices are used to collect the harvested material from the plants and store it in their respective collection boxes 50, thus simultaneously performing both harvesting and collection functions, effectively improving the efficiency of large-scale harvesting and reducing labor costs.

[0061] Specifically, the transmission device 40 can be a single component or it can be composed of the first conveyor belt mechanism 41 and the second conveyor belt mechanism 42 below. The choice can be made based on factors such as actual manufacturing, assembly, harvesting effect and manufacturing cost.

[0062] Among the optional solutions in this embodiment, the more preferred one is as follows: Figure 1 and Figure 3 As shown, the conveying device includes a first conveyor belt mechanism 41 and a second conveyor belt mechanism 42. The first conveyor belt mechanism 41 is mounted on the frame 10 below the toothed brush device 20 on the same side. The second conveyor belt mechanism 42 is positioned between the first conveyor belt mechanism 41 and the corresponding collection box 50. The collection box 50 is vertically higher than the first conveyor belt mechanism 41. The first conveyor belt mechanism 41 has a first conveying surface, and the second conveyor belt mechanism 42 has a second conveying surface. The output end of the first conveying surface is connected to the input end of the second conveying surface, and the output end of the second conveying surface is connected and communicates with the collection box 50. By positioning the collection box 50 higher than the first conveyor belt mechanism 41, the storage capacity of the collection box 50 is increased vertically while minimizing the space occupied by its length in the first direction. This results in a shorter overall length of the device, improving maneuverability. Furthermore, the first conveyor belt mechanism 41 and the second conveyor belt mechanism 42 can collect the harvested materials into the collection box 50, resulting in a simple, stable, and reliable structure.

[0063] Specifically, the operating power of the first conveyor belt mechanism 41 and the second conveyor belt mechanism 42 can be provided by hydraulic motors.

[0064] Among the optional solutions in this embodiment, the more preferred one is as follows: Figures 3-5 As shown, two flower-catching scale plate assemblies 60 are rotatably arranged within the harvesting gap 11. The two flower-catching scale plate assemblies 60 are arranged opposite each other, and the gap between the two flower-catching scale plate assemblies 60 is used to clamp and fix the lower end of the harvested plant. Elastic elements are provided on the flower-catching scale plate assemblies 60, which can keep one side of the flower-catching scale plate assemblies 60 close to the other flower-catching scale plate assemblies 60. The two flower-catching scale plate assemblies 60 have conformal self-adaptive capabilities, that is, they can adjust the position of the harvested plant within the harvesting gap 11 through the elastic force of the elastic elements, adaptively adjusting for row deviations, thereby ensuring that the toothed comb brush devices 20 on both sides can evenly and effectively harvest the harvested plant within the harvesting gap 11. Furthermore, the two flower-catching scale plate assemblies 60 can seal the lower end of the harvested plant, ensuring that the harvested material does not fall into the field from the gap after falling off, thus improving collection efficiency.

[0065] Specifically, the flower scale plate assembly 60 consists of multiple plates, each plate being provided with tension by an elastic element, which can be a tension spring structure. Each plate can automatically reset under the tension of the elastic element after the harvested plant passes through, thereby keeping the harvesting gap 11 isolated from the ground.

[0066] Specifically, the two flower-grafting plate groups 60 can ensure that the harvested plants pass smoothly during the harvesting process while keeping the lower end of the harvested plants closed, thus collecting as much of the harvested material as possible.

[0067] Among the optional solutions in this embodiment, the more preferred one is as follows: Figure 5 As shown, in the vertical direction, the side of the flower-collecting scale assembly 60 closest to another flower-collecting scale assembly 60 is higher than the side of that flower-collecting scale assembly 60 furthest from another flower-collecting scale assembly 60, and the side of that flower-collecting scale assembly 60 furthest from another flower-collecting scale assembly 60 is not lower than the first conveying surface. The flower-collecting scale assembly 60 is configured with one side higher than the other, so that the harvested material can fall onto the flower-collecting scale assembly 60 and automatically roll down to the corresponding position by its tilt and its own weight, avoiding accumulation at the position where the harvested plant is held, thus improving the collection efficiency.

[0068] Specifically, the inclination angle of the 60-section flower scale plate assembly is 15°.

[0069] Among the optional solutions in this embodiment, the more preferred one is as follows: Figure 1 and Figure 2 As shown, along the first direction, a branch gathering device 70 is also provided on the front side of the machine frame 10. The branch gathering device 70 has a gathering gap, the end of which is connected to and communicates with the input end of the harvesting gap 11, and the distance of the front end of the gathering gap along the second direction is greater than the distance of the harvesting gap 11 along the second direction. The branch gathering device 70 can gather the harvested plants, thereby facilitating the accurate introduction of the harvested plants into the harvesting gap 11 for subsequent harvesting work.

[0070] Specifically, the branch gathering device 70 can be as follows: Figure 2 The plate structure shown can also be a branch-gathering structure of other existing structural types.

[0071] Among the optional solutions in this embodiment, the more preferred one is as follows: Figure 1 and Figure 2 As shown, the walking system includes a power system 14 and a walking mechanism. The power system 14 is fixedly mounted on the frame 10 above the collection box 50, and the walking mechanism is located at the lower end of the frame 10. The power system 14 is used to drive the walking mechanism, and the walking mechanism can drive the frame 10 to move. By using the power system 14 mounted on the frame 10 to provide driving force, and the walking mechanism to achieve the self-propelled function of the equipment, the system has a high degree of integration, does not require traction equipment, and is more flexible and reliable.

[0072] Specifically, the power system 14 can be an engine or a combination of battery and motor, which can be selected according to actual needs.

[0073] Specifically, the walking mechanism includes four walking wheels 13, and the power system 14 can drive the four walking wheels 13 to rotate.

[0074] Specifically, a lifting device can be installed between the walking mechanism and the machine frame 10 to adjust the height of the machine frame 10 off the ground. The lifting device can be hydraulic.

[0075] Among the optional solutions in this embodiment, the more preferred one is as follows: Figure 1 and Figure 2 As shown, the toothed belt comb harvester 100 also includes a driver's cab 15, which is located on the machine frame 10 above the harvesting mechanism, and along the first direction, the driver's cab 15 is located in front of the power system 14. Positioning the driver's cab 15 above and in front of the machine frame 10 serves two purposes: firstly, it helps to balance the center of gravity of the equipment, ensuring its stability; secondly, the driver's cab 15's front position allows the operator to more clearly and intuitively see the plants to be harvested, facilitating alignment with the harvesting gap 11 and achieving highly efficient and precise harvesting.

[0076] Specifically, the cab 15 is equipped with control buttons or levers for controlling the power system 14, the walking mechanism, the lifting device, the conveying device, and the picking mechanism.

[0077] Specifically, a guardrail 16 is also provided around the cab 15 and the power system 14. The guardrail 16 is used to fix the machine frame 10.

[0078] Specifically, the machine frame 10 is also equipped with an escalator 17 to facilitate the driver's access to and from the cab 15.

[0079] Specifically, taking honeysuckle harvesting as an example: During honeysuckle harvesting, the traveling mechanism adjusts the height of the equipment chassis off the ground via a lifting device. The driver, inside the cab 15, precisely aligns the equipment with the honeysuckle plant. Once the device is running smoothly, the operation begins. As the machine advances, the honeysuckle branches are gathered by the branch gathering device 70 and enter the harvesting area. The toothed brush devices 20, located on both sides of the honeysuckle plant within the harvesting gap 11, brush the branches on the honeysuckle plant to pick the honeysuckle buds. The brushed-off honeysuckle flowers fall onto the flower-collecting scale plate group 60. Since the flower-collecting scale plate group 60 is inclined and positioned on one side of the first conveyor belt mechanism 41, the buds falling onto the flower-collecting scale plate group 60 slide into the first conveyor belt mechanism 41, then through the second conveyor belt mechanism 42, and finally fall into the corresponding collection box 50. Harvesting continues as the machine travels until the honeysuckle harvesting operation is completed.
